IBM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2023 in Review

2,392 of the 6,275 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in IBM (IBM) for Q1 2023, worth a combined $67.6B — down 12% from $76.8B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 153 funds opened new IBM positions and 143 closed out — a net gain of 10 holders — while 1,044 added to existing stakes and 889 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Norges Bank, adding an estimated $345M. The largest seller was Charles Schwab, cutting an estimated $1.64B.
